An exceptional, fine and impressive pair of antique Victorian English sterling silver fish servers - boxed; an addition to our silver flatware collection
This exceptional pair of antique Victorian boxed silver fish servers, in sterling standard, consists of a serving knife and fork.
The blade of the knife and the drop of the fork have an incurved shaped form.
The anterior of the knife is embellished with a bright cut engraved band of leaf ornamentation paralleling the shaped side of the blade, accented with a suspended floral festoon and fabric swag designs.
The drop of the fork is ornamented with further bright cut engraved floral festoon designs extending from a wrigglework decorated border to the lower portion of the four tines.
The posterior surface of each shaped blade is plain and embellished with a paralleling scalloped border to the incurved edge.
